Well with the help of epsy I figured out what I was doing wrong before, and from using my own cockpit with rubber meters added over everyone's lightcycle, I have to say there isn't that huge of an advantage. The only areas that it helps in, are: You can see whether you can "beat someone's grind", so if you see it go in the red you shouldn't attempt it, if it is green go for it, if it is orange grind hard. The other area is; if you see that someone is in the red you can go straight for the kill since you know they don't have much room to maneuver.
Both of those scenarios are fairly common, and most people that have played for a while can usually tell what to do anyways. I ended up putting it as a toggle and having it default as off, like I did with the impact meters, because I did find myself looking at it too often, getting distracted, and dying quite a bit.
